"Escape to Witch Mountain" is a beloved 1975 adventure film directed by John Hough that follows the extraordinary journey of two mysterious orphaned siblings, Tony and Tia, who possess magical powers. Eddie Albert stars as Jason O'Day, a kind-hearted man who befriends the siblings and helps them unravel the secrets of their past. As they embark on a thrilling adventure, they discover their true identities and their connection to the enigmatic Witch Mountain. Kim Richards and Ike Eisenmann shine as the charismatic young leads, while Donald Pleasence and Ray Milland deliver captivating performances as they become entangled in the siblings' quest for truth and belonging.
